The second season of "What If...?" is an animated show in the United States. It's based on Marvel Comics and explores different stories in the multiverse. The series imagines what would happen if important moments in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U) movies went differently.
Marvel Studios Animation makes the show, with A. C. Bradley as the main writer and Bryan Andrews as the director. The animation is done by Flying Bark Productions, Stellar Creative Lab, and SDFX Studios. Jeffrey Wright is the voice of the Watcher, who tells the stories, and many actors from MCU movies reprise their roles. The new season started on December 22, 2023, on Disney+, with one episode released each day until December 30. It's part of Phase Five of the MCU.

What If Season 2 Episode 4 Ending Explained
In "What If...?" Season 2 Episode 4, the story revolves around Tony Stark landing on Sakaar and facing challenges orchestrated by the Grandmaster. Gamora seeks revenge on Tony for her past with Thanos, leading to unexpected alliances and a race for control of the planet. In the end, Tony wins the race but faces a triple-cross as Gamora takes him to meet Thanos. Surprisingly, they team up to defeat the Mad Titan, showcasing a twist in the narrative.
While The Watcher introduces it as Gamora's journey, the episode delves into Tony's experiences on Sakaar, leading to a collaborative effort to confront Thanos.

"What If...?" is a cartoon show in the United States made for Disney+ by A. C. Bradley. It's based on Marvel Comics and is the fourth TV series in the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U) by Marvel Studios. The show explores different stories in the multiverse, imagining how things would change if important moments in MCU movies happened differently.
The Watcher, voiced by Jeffrey Wright, tells the stories, and many actors from MCU movies are in it. The series started development in 2018 and was officially announced in 2019. The first season came out on August 11, 2021, and the second season started on December 22, 2023. It will have nine episodes released daily until December 30. People generally like the show, especially the voice acting, animation, and creative stories, but some think the episodes could be longer and the writing could be better. There's also news about a third season and a spin-off called Marvel Zombies in the works.

What If Season 2 Episode 4 Plot
In What If...? Season 2, Episode 4, we follow the story of the Guardians of the Multiverse. It's about Gamora becoming really powerful. Tony Stark ends up stuck on a planet called Sakaar after his spaceship crashes into the Grandmaster's palace. Gamora is angry at Tony and wants to get back at him.
But something unexpected happens: Tony and Gamora decide to work together, even though they're not a likely team. They join forces to fight against Thanos. This shows how Gamora changes and chooses her own path, becoming stronger and deciding who she wants to be.
